Hello, I have a problem with my PC that I assembled a few weeks ago.

The issue I'm having is that when I turn off my PC, the devices with LEDs connected to the USB ports continue to receive power. I would like to know how to disable this option.

I've tried to disable it in the BIOS.

P.S.: Gigabyte B660 Gaming X DDR4 motherboard.

    Problem solved for those having the same issue as me: you need to disable the USB settings in the power options, as well as disable the fast startup of Windows and enable eRT in the BIOS.
